Bottle at Wtf 2, pours a very dark brown with small beige head that lasts. The aroma is strong cherry skin, wood, roast. Medium mouth, tart cherry, wood, chocolate, light roast finish, very good.

Bottle: Poured a dark burgundy color ale with a large off-white foamy head with light retention. Aroma of sweet dry fruits, with some light chocolate notes and some bourbon/vanilla notes. Taste is a complex mix of chocolate, sweet dry fruits notes, light molasses, some residual sugar notes and some bourbon and vanilla notes. Body is about average with good carbonation with no apparent alcohol. Intriguing experiment with great flavours but lacking some cohesion.

A hazed dark amber brown ale with a thin mocha head. In aroma, sweet fruity caramel malt with treacle, candy sugar, dark fruits, plums, licorice notes, very nice. In mouth, a nice sweet fruity malt with light coconut oil, chocolate, light coffee, treacle and dark fruits, molasses, alcohol warmth, very nice. Bottle from Boutip.

[2/27/15] Draught at The Commons Brewery in Portland. Nice deep reddish brown. Lovely aroma of bourbon, vanilla, cookies, chocolate and some dark fruits. Sweet flavor with chocolate, vanilla, cookies, some fruitiness and a tart cherry note. Medium-bodied. Very good.
